The Story

MoMA Exclusive: A branch from a cherry blossom tree, grown and harvested in Japan, is captured in acrylic and resin to create a permanent moment of beauty in your home. The Cherry Blossom Objet d’Art is the brainchild of artist and cinematographer Takao Inoue, who enjoys capturing simple, ephemeral moments to “stare at you [and] make you happy,” and is known for creating similar works with dandelions and tulips. “Even if the cherry blossoms are in full bloom, once they start to fall, all the petals will fall at once,” says Inoue. “I'm particularly attracted to the petals when they start to fall.” The Cherry Blossom Objet d’Art is made in Japan and measures 6.75h x 2.75w x 2.75”d.
